Problems solved by technology

[0004] 1. Due to the lack of accurate basic data, the load characteristic indicators in the current demand response system mainly rely on empirical estimation, and the accuracy of load forecasting is not high
[0005] 2. Due to the large number of power users, the amount of data involved in the analysis of load characteristics is very large. At present, the demand response system lacks a reasonable screening method, and the accuracy of data analysis is not high.
[0006] 3. At present, the evaluation effect of demand response in demand side management is affected by complex factors such as data time lag, nonlinearity, feedback, dynamics, data insufficiency, and human factors, and lacks quantitative analysis
[0007] 4. The load management means of the existing demand side management system is relatively single, and the relevant theories and technical means have not yet formed a complete system

Abstract

The invention discloses an automatic demand response evaluation system and method for demand side management. The system comprises a data acquisition module, a user demand response implementation effect evaluation module, a user simulation settlement module, a user assessment record module and a regional power grid response capability evaluation module. Demand response data can be reasonably evaluated, a basis is provided for improving demand response, the implementation effect of demand response can be better improved continuously, and the vital function of demand response on regional energy optimization is fully achieved.

technical field [0001] The invention relates to an automatic demand response evaluation system and method for demand side management. Background technique [0002] Demand-side management refers to the designed action planning and design schemes of electric power enterprises, through which the grid activities are planned, executed and monitored, and these grid activities affect the power consumption of users according to the expected load waveform changes of the grid. As one of the means of demand-side management, the demand response strategy refers to the operation mechanism in which power users respond to economic incentive policies such as electricity prices of power supply companies, guide users to adjust power consumption patterns, and transfer part of the power load to the low-peak period of the power grid to ensure the power balance of the power grid.
